The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of James Dearman, born in 1839 in , consisted of 5 members. James was the head of the household, married to Sarah Dearman, born in 1843 in Earlswood, Surrey, England. They had 3 children; Arthur (born 1870 in Kensington, Middlesex, England), Flora (born 1873 in Kensington, Middlesex, England) and Clara (born 1876 in Kensington, Middlesex, England).
